How do I identify my Harley Davidson motor?

Look on left side of the engine case for the engine number. Harley engines that were made before or in the 1960s have the model year of the engine as the first two numbers of the engine number, which acts as a VIN. Look for a four-digit production code in the last four digits of the VIN.

How is the displacement of an engine determined?

Engine displacement is determined from the bore and stroke of an engine’s cylinders.

What is the displacement of a four stroke engine?

Engine displacement. One complete cycle of a four-cylinder, four-stroke engine. The volume displaced is marked in orange. Engine displacement is the swept volume of all the pistons inside the cylinders of a reciprocating engine in a single movement from top dead centre (TDC) to bottom dead centre (BDC).

How big is the engine displacement of a moped?

In France and some other EU countries, mopeds of less than 50 cm 3 displacement (and usually with a two-stroke engine), can be driven with minimum qualifications (previously, they could be driven by any person over 14). This led to all light motorbikes having a displacement of about 49.9 cm 3.

How is the displacement of an engine measured?

What Is Engine Displacement? Engine displacement is the total swept volume of air created by the pistons as they move up and down in each cylinder. Whether you have an engine that is four, six, or eight cylinders, the engine displacement is all measured the same way.
